About This Item

Orangeville, Ontario: Penny Farthing Publications, 1980. 1st Edition 1st Printing. Paperback. Near Fine. 1st printing - 600 copies. Orange, stapled card covers with archival photo on face. 74 pages with B&W illustrations. 8vo - over 7¾ - 9¾" tall
